Skip to content

Commit

Permalink
Sign bug correction in projectorOutput.run
Browse files Browse the repository at this point in the history
  • Loading branch information
Nicolas Omont authored and sylvlecl committed Nov 28, 2018
1 parent bb87eef commit aac798c
Showing 1 changed file with 12 additions and 12 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-256,10 +256,10 @@ printf "%s %.1f\n", "sommeQapres", sum {(g,n) in UNITCC} unit_Q[g,n] > projecto

# Variations totales et moyennes P,Q
let tempo := 1.0 / card(UNITCC);
printf "%s %.1f\n", "variationTotaleP", sum {(g,n) in UNITCC} abs(unit_P[g,n] - unit_P0[g,n]) > projector_results_indic.txt;
printf "%s %.1f\n", "variationTotaleQ", sum {(g,n) in UNITCC} abs(unit_Q[g,n] - unit_Q0[g,n]) > projector_results_indic.txt;
printf "%s %.2f\n", "variationMoyenneP", tempo * sum {(g,n) in UNITCC} abs(unit_P[g,n] - unit_P0[g,n]) > projector_results_indic.txt;
printf "%s %.2f\n", "variationMoyenneQ", tempo * sum {(g,n) in UNITCC} abs(unit_Q[g,n] - unit_Q0[g,n]) > projector_results_indic.txt;
printf "%s %.1f\n", "variationTotaleP", sum {(g,n) in UNITCC} abs(unit_P[g,n] + unit_P0[g,n]) > projector_results_indic.txt;
printf "%s %.1f\n", "variationTotaleQ", sum {(g,n) in UNITCC} abs(unit_Q[g,n] + unit_Q0[g,n]) > projector_results_indic.txt;
printf "%s %.2f\n", "variationMoyenneP", tempo * sum {(g,n) in UNITCC} abs(unit_P[g,n] + unit_P0[g,n]) > projector_results_indic.txt;
printf "%s %.2f\n", "variationMoyenneQ", tempo * sum {(g,n) in UNITCC} abs(unit_Q[g,n] + unit_Q0[g,n]) > projector_results_indic.txt;

# Moyennes Tensions
let tempo := card({(g,n) in UNITCC: unit_vregul[g,n]=="true"});
Expand All @@ -270,16 +270,16 @@ if tempo > 0 then {
}

# Nombre de groupes modifies P
printf "%s %i\n", "nbGroupesPmodifie01MW", card({(g,n) in UNITCC : abs(unit_P[g,n] - unit_P0[g,n]) >= 0.1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esPmodifie1MW", card({(g,n) in UNITCC : abs(unit_P[g,n] - unit_P0[g,n]) >= 1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esPmodifie10MW", card({(g,n) in UNITCC : abs(unit_P[g,n] - unit_P0[g,n]) >= 10 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esPmodifie100MW", card({(g,n) in UNITCC : abs(unit_P[g,n] - unit_P0[g,n]) >= 100 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esPmodifie01MW", card({(g,n) in UNITCC : abs(unit_P[g,n] + unit_P0[g,n]) >= 0.1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esPmodifie1MW", card({(g,n) in UNITCC : abs(unit_P[g,n] + unit_P0[g,n]) >= 1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esPmodifie10MW", card({(g,n) in UNITCC : abs(unit_P[g,n] + unit_P0[g,n]) >= 10 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esPmodifie100MW", card({(g,n) in UNITCC : abs(unit_P[g,n] + unit_P0[g,n]) >= 100 } ) > projector_results_indic.txt;

# Nombre de groupes modifies Q
printf "%s %i\n", "nbGroupesQmodifie01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] - unit_Q0[g,n]) >= 0.1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esQmodifie1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] - unit_Q0[g,n]) >= 1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esQmodifie10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] - unit_Q0[g,n]) >= 10 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esQmodifie100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] - unit_Q0[g,n]) >= 100 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esQmodifie01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] + unit_Q0[g,n]) >= 0.1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esQmodifie1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] + unit_Q0[g,n]) >= 1 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esQmodifie10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] + unit_Q0[g,n]) >= 10 } ) > projector_results_indic.txt;
printf "%s %i\n", "nbGroupesQmodifie100Mvar", card({(g,n) in UNITCC : abs(unit_Q[g,n] + unit_Q0[g,n]) >= 100 } ) > projector_results_indic.txt;

# Nombre de groupes modifies V
printf "%s %i\n", "nbGroupesVmodifie01kV",
Expand Down

0 comments on commit aac798c

Please sign in to comment.